LINE WITH PRESS IN HONG KONG

8.

Hong Kong naturally came up in our bilateral discussions, We agreed on the importance of maintaining stability and confidence.

I am convinced of the seriousness of Chinese assurances to investors

in Hong Kong. Meanwhile our relations with China and practical cooperation over Hong Kong are first class.

9.

(If asked whether any agreement with China on 1997 was

sought) I was in China to learn. It was right at this stage to

concentrate on getting their views on a range of problems.

10. (If asked and depending on status of Prime Minsiter's visit)

Mrs Thatcher agreed with Chinese leaders in 1979 to keep in touch

with the Chinese Government on Hong Kong. Her visit will provide

an opportunity to do this.
